Overview and Description
The Egypt Impact Lab (EIL) and the European Training Foundation (ETF) are hosting a learning event that combines high-level policy dialogue with practical technical training to build sustainable evidence ecosystems in education and employment.
The program is structured to:
- Connect policymakers with implementation expertise
- Build technical capacity in evaluation methodologies
- Foster international learning networks
- Enable evidence-based program scaling
The morning opening session combines keynote addresses from government leaders and a structured panel discussion among international experts, creating a unique platform for meaningful dialogue on institutional capacity building and regional cooperation.
The remaining two-day program is a comprehensive learning event designed to build technical capacity in evaluation methodologies and foster a community of practice among implementation partners.
The event progresses from high-level policy discussions to hands-on training sessions in impact evaluation methods where technical participants will engage in interactive learning sessions, case studies, and practical exercises that will enhance their ability to design, implement, and evaluate evidence-based programs in technical education and labor market policies.
